Structure and Working Principle
The automatic sampling bag inflator typically consists of a gas intake system, a flow control mechanism, and a bag attachment interface. The gas intake system draws in air or gas from the environment or a specific source. The flow control mechanism regulates the volume and rate of gas flow into the sampling bag, ensuring precise filling. The device may include features like pressure sensors and automatic shut-off to prevent over-inflation. Some models are equipped with digital displays for real-time monitoring of flow rates and volumes. The working principle revolves around maintaining a consistent and contamination-free flow of gas into the sampling bag, which is essential for accurate sample analysis.

Application Areas
Automatic sampling bag inflators are widely used in environmental monitoring to collect air samples for pollution analysis. They are also essential in industrial settings, such as chemical plants, where gas samples need to be collected for quality control and safety checks. In laboratories, these devices are used for research purposes, ensuring that gas samples are collected accurately for experiments and analysis. Other applications include occupational health monitoring, where workers' exposure to hazardous gases is assessed, and food packaging, where modified atmosphere packaging requires precise gas mixtures.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and accuracy of an automatic sampling bag inflator. Calibration should be performed periodically to maintain precise flow rates. Cleaning the device after each use prevents contamination and ensures reliable performance. It is also important to store the inflator in a clean, dry environment to avoid damage to sensitive components. Users should follow the manufacturer's guidelines for operation and maintenance to prevent malfunctions. Proper handling and storage of sampling bags are equally important to avoid leaks or contamination during the sampling process.
